The probability of the Fed cutting interest rates by 25 basis points in December is now 96%.

PANews reported on December 14 that according to CME's "Fed Watch", the probability that the Federal Reserve will maintain the current interest rate unchanged by December is 4%, and the probability of a cumulative interest rate cut of 25 basis points is 96%.
